Output 8c684840d7931d9a8b3a8c901b5cf91f3f510267a16a771380c49a476374a18b:0

value
1548556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 283f9184bfd2fc3d825d8c807addb42bccba55d5 OP_EQUAL
address
35Mq72dy5YWVrSK76XgcogqMGGSN8N6uuk
transaction
8c684840d7931d9a8b3a8c901b5cf91f3f510267a16a771380c49a476374a18b
confirmations
270512
spent
true